-+### Supported build tags
-+
-+- `containers_image_openpgp`: Use a Golang-only OpenPGP implementation for 
signature verification instead of the default cgo/gpgme-based implementation;
- the primary downside is that creating new signatures with the Golang-only 
implementation is not supported.
-+- `containers_image_ostree_stub`: Instead of importing `ostree:` transport in 
`github.com/containers/image/transports/alltransports`, use a stub which 
reports that the transport is not supported. This allows building the library 
without requiring the `libostree` development libraries.
-+
-+  (Note that explicitly importing `github.com/containers/image/ostree` will 
still depend on the `libostree` library, this build tag only affects generic 
users of …`/alltransports`.)
